Ubuntu LTS Lifecycle — Which Version Should You Use?

Ubuntu LTS (Long Term Support) releases receive 5 years of free security updates from Canonical. Here's the full support timeline and why it matters for your VPS server.

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ver)EOL: April 2023 End of Life — Legacy Only
Ubuntu 20.04 LTS (Focal Fossa)EOL: April 2025 Approaching EOL — Plan Migration Now
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)Supported Until: April 2027 Fully Supported — Stable Choice
Ubuntu 24.04 LTS (Noble Numbat)Supported Until: April 2029 Latest LTS — Recommended

Still on Ubuntu 18.04 or 20.04? Time to Upgrade.

Ubuntu 18.04 reached EOL in April 2023. Ubuntu 20.04 EOL arrives April 2025. Running EOL Ubuntu in production means no free security patches from Canonical — your server is exposed to known vulnerabilities. Ubuntu LTS (Long Term Support) releases receive 5 years of free security updates from Canonical, making them ideal for production servers. Non-LTS releases (e.g. Ubuntu 23.04, 23.10) only receive 9 months of support and are not suitable for long-running production servers. For VPS hosting, always use an LTS release — Ubuntu 24.04 LTS (until 2029) or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(until 2027) are the recommended choices.
